#e64856 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e64856 is composed of 90.2% red, 28.2%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 68.7% magenta, 62.6%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 354.7 degrees, a saturation of 76% and a lightness of 59.2%. #e64856 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ff90ac with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

Shades and Tints of #e64856

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070101 is the darkest color, while #fef5f5 is the lightest one.
